Analysis
In 2023, seed — cropland potassium per unit area in Middle Africa stood at 0.2312 kg/ha.
The figure is down 1.6% on the previous year and down 3.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, seed — cropland potassium per unit area in Middle Africa peaked at 0.2954 kg/ha in 2004 and was at its lowest, 0.1729 kg/ha, in 1988.
That places Middle Africa 26th out of 32 groups with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 63 years of available data.

About this data
The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
